Gordon found Europe in the 1960s a much easier place to live, saying that he experienced less racism and greater respect for jazz musicians. Gordon had a genial and humorous stage presence. He was an advocate of playing to communicate with the audience, which was his musical approach as well. One of his idiosyncratic rituals was to recite lyrics from each ballad before playing it.

Gordon was married three times and had five children: daughters Robin and Deirdre and sons Mikael, Benjamin, and Woody Louis Armstrong Shaw.

Gordon's father, Dr. Frank Gordon, M.D., was one of the first prominent African-American physicians and a graduate of

Gordon also visited the US occasionally for further recording dates.
